What affects the price

Medicare pricing isn't a one-size-fits-all situation. Several variables influence what you might pay each month. Your specific location is a major factor, as costs change depending on the state or county where you reside. Another key element is the type of plan you select, such as a Medicare Advantage plan versus a standalone prescription drug policy. How do I know if I'm eligible for Medicare in Philadelphia?

In Philadelphia, you're generally eligible for Medicare if you're 65 or older. You may also be eligible if you have a disability or End-Stage Renal Disease. You usually need to have worked and paid Medicare taxes for at least 10 years. Checking your specific situation with Medicare is the best way to confirm eligibility.

What does Medicare Part B cover in Philadelphia?

Medicare Part B in Philadelphia covers doctor services, outpatient care, and medical supplies. This includes preventive services like flu shots and screenings. It also covers durable medical equipment. You typically pay a monthly premium for Part B coverage. It's essential for accessing many healthcare services.

Can I supplement my Medicare in Philadelphia?

Yes, you can supplement your Medicare in Philadelphia. Supplemental plans, like Medicare Supplement Insurance (Medigap), can help cover costs that Original Medicare doesn't. These plans pay for things like deductibles, copayments, and coinsurance. They work alongside your Part A and Part B coverage.

Does Medicare pay for in-home care services in Philadelphia?

Medicare in Philadelphia can pay for limited in-home care if it's medically necessary. This typically includes skilled nursing care, physical therapy, or occupational therapy provided by a home health agency. It generally does not cover long-term custodial care or personal assistance unless it's part of a skilled care plan.
